The Bin Zayed Group send NEW takeover message to NUFC fans – Over to you Mike Ashley..

A NEW takeover statement has now been released ‘following a meeting’ between Peter Redding (Dubai-based radio presenter) and Bin Zayed Group officials.

Here’s the latest from the Middle-East, with Capital Radio’s Peter Redding claiming the BZG wanted to put the following on the record for the benefit of Newcastle United fans:

“Both parties have worked diligently in finalising a deal, none more so than ourselves. We have completed every aspect required in a takeover process.

“Press claims of no bids or Premier League approval processes are simply untrue.

“The current owners have cooperated amicably throughout this process and if a deal is not forthcoming it will not be due to lack of effort from both parties”
